+/*
|
|
|
+ * This is a workaround since there is no vendor specific command to retrieve
|
|
|
+ * ca_info using AVC. If this parameter is not used, ca_system_id will be
|
|
|
+ * filled with application_manufacturer from ca_app_info.
|
|
|
+ * Digital Everywhere have said that adding ca_info is on their TODO list.
|
|
|
+ */
|
|
|
+static unsigned int num_fake_ca_system_ids;
|
|
|
+static int fake_ca_system_ids[4] = { -1, -1, -1, -1 };
|
|
|
+module_param_array(fake_ca_system_ids, int, &num_fake_ca_system_ids, 0644);
|
|
|
+MODULE_PARM_DESC(fake_ca_system_ids, "If your CAM application manufacturer "
|
|
|
+ "does not have the same ca_system_id as your CAS, you can "
|
|
|
+ "override what ca_system_ids are presented to the "
|
|
|
+ "application by setting this field to an array of ids.");
